Prosopis pubescens

Benth.
Tracheophyta » Fabales » Fabaceae » Prosopis pubescens
Common name (English)
Screw-bean
Ηabitat
I1 Arable

Hold Ctrl whilst dragging to view details of selected occurrences.

Establishment status
Not Established
Establishment status detail

Alien: Has been grown in Salamis and at Larnaca. It is of considerable interest as a botanical curiosity, and has some value as a bee-plant and animal foodstuff, but is generally less usefull than P. juliflora (Meikle 1977).

First detection year
1915
Pathway
2 ESCAPE FROM CONFINEMENT - Agriculture – Ag
Pathway detail

As the species is not established introduction pathways are indicated in case of possible/potential escape from confinement.
